Treatment
Lifestyle modifications to diet, and exercise regimen, stopping smoking, losing weight, reduce salt intake.
Thiazide diuretics, angiotensin 2 blocking agents, Ca channel blockers, beta blockers, ACE inhibitors, ARB.
Pathophysiology
Genetics and the environment lead to inflammation, obesity, insulin resistance, dysfunction of the SNS, RAA, and natriuretic hormones.
Vasoconstriction, renal salt and water retention
Increased peripheral vascular resistance, increased blood volume

Diagnosis
Two separate blood pressure readings at least two minutes apart, on two separate occasions.
-
CBC, UA, biochemical profile, and ECG
